The color #733120 is a red that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 115, 49, 32 and HSL values of 12°, 56%, 29%.

Complementary Colors for #733120

The complementary color for #733120 is #216373.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#733120

The analogous colors for #733120 are #732139 and #735B21.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#733120

The triadic colors for #733120 are #217331 and #312173.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
